excel公式里固定一个值的函数是什么
作者:百问excel教程网
|
88人看过
发布时间:2026-03-16 21:53:46
在Excel中,若要在公式中固定一个值,最核心的方法是使用“绝对引用”,这并非一个独立的函数,而是通过在单元格地址的行号与列标前添加美元符号($)来实现的锁定机制,它能确保公式在复制或填充时,被固定的单元格引用不会发生改变。理解这一概念是掌握Excel高效计算的关键一步。
许多刚开始接触Excel的朋友,常常会遇到一个令人困惑的情况:自己精心设计好的公式,一拖动填充柄复制到其他单元格,计算结果就全乱套了。原本想用某个固定的数值去乘一系列变动的数据,结果那个“固定”的数值也跟着跑偏了。这时,你脑海中自然会浮现一个疑问:“excel公式里固定一个值的函数是什么”?实际上,这并不是一个可以通过输入某个函数名如“固定()”就能解决的问题,它涉及的是Excel公式中一个更为基础且至关重要的概念——单元格的引用方式。
理解绝对引用与相对引用的区别 要彻底弄明白如何在公式里固定一个值,我们必须先分清两种最基本的引用类型:相对引用和绝对引用。想象一下,你在一张网格纸上记笔记。相对引用就像你对朋友说:“答案在我右手边第三个格子里。”这个描述是相对的,取决于你(公式单元格)坐在哪里。如果你移动了位置,你朋友再按这个描述去找,找到的就不再是原来的答案了。在Excel中,我们直接写“A1”或“B2”,就是相对引用。当公式被复制到其他单元格时,Excel会自动调整这个地址。例如,在C1单元格输入“=A1+B1”,然后将公式向下拖动到C2,公式会自动变成“=A2+B2”。 而绝对引用,则像是你给出了一个绝对坐标:“答案在B列第5行。”无论你走到表格的哪个位置,这个坐标指向的格子始终是B5,雷打不动。在Excel里,我们通过在列标(字母)和行号(数字)前加上美元符号($)来实现绝对引用。所以,要绝对引用B5单元格,就写成“$B$5”。这个美元符号就像一个“锁”,锁住了列,也锁住了行,让它不再随公式位置的变化而变化。 美元符号($)的三种锁定模式 很多人误以为固定一个值就只有“全锁定”这一种方式。其实,根据你的需要,美元符号可以灵活地只锁行、只锁列,或者行列全锁。这构成了三种锁定模式:第一种是“$A$1”,即绝对引用,行列均固定。这是最彻底的“固定”,适用于像税率、单价、固定系数这类需要完全不变的基准值。第二种是“A$1”,这叫混合引用,行绝对而列相对。它锁定了第1行,但列可以变动。当你需要固定参照某一行(比如标题行)的数据,而列方向需要自动填充时,就用这种。第三种是“$A1”,也是混合引用,列绝对而行相对。它锁定了A列,但行可以变动。这在你需要固定参照某一列(比如产品编号列)的数据,而行方向需要向下计算时非常有用。 一个经典的应用场景:制作九九乘法表 让我们用一个制作九九乘法表的例子,来直观感受混合引用的魔力。假设我们在B2单元格输入公式“=B$1$A2”。这里,“B$1”表示引用第一行(行号前有$)的数值,但列可以随公式右移而从B变成C、D……;“$A2”表示引用A列(列标前有$)的数值,但行可以随公式下拉而从2变成3、4……。当你将这个公式向右再向下填充至整个9x9的区域时,它会自动生成完整的乘法表。通过巧妙地只锁定行或只锁定列,我们用一个公式就完成了整个表格的计算,这正是理解了“固定一个值”的精髓所在。 在函数参数中固定数值或区域 除了在基本的算术公式中,在各类函数里固定值同样关键。比如,使用求和函数(SUM)时,你希望始终对A列的数据求和,无论公式放在哪里,那么求和区域就应该写成“$A:$A”,这表示绝对引用整A列。又比如,在使用查找函数VLOOKUP时,你的查找范围(table_array)参数通常需要被完全固定,否则下拉公式时查找区域会下移,导致找不到数据。这时,就应该将范围写成“$A$2:$D$100”这样的绝对引用形式。 利用名称管理器实现高级“固定” 对于更复杂的表格或需要反复使用的固定值,使用“名称”是一个极佳的选择。你可以在“公式”选项卡下找到“名称管理器”,为某个单元格、常量值甚至一个公式定义一个有意义的名称,例如将存放税率的单元格B1命名为“税率”。之后,在任何公式中,你都可以直接输入“=单价税率”,而不必关心“税率”这个名称具体指向哪个单元格地址。即使未来税率单元格的位置发生了移动,只要在名称管理器中重新定义其引用位置,所有使用该名称的公式都会自动更新。这是一种更智能、更易于维护的“固定”方式。 快速切换引用方式的快捷键 在编辑栏中手动输入美元符号效率较低。Excel提供了一个非常高效的快捷键:F4键。当你在编辑公式,并用鼠标选中或输入了一个单元格地址(如A1)后,按下F4键,它会在“A1”、“$A$1”、“A$1”、“$A1”这四种引用模式间循环切换。你可以根据需要快速定格在想要的模式上,这能极大提升公式编辑的速度。 固定值与常量数组的结合 有时,你需要固定的不是一个单元格的值,而是一组固定的常数。这时,可以使用常量数组。例如,你想用一组固定的权重0.3, 0.5, 0.2去计算综合得分,可以在公式中直接写入这个数组,并用大括号括起来。虽然数组本身不是通过美元符号固定的,但它作为公式内的硬编码值,也不会随单元格位置改变,实现了“固定一组值”的效果。不过,直接使用常量数组的缺点是修改不便,不如引用单元格灵活。 在数据验证中应用固定列表 数据验证(数据有效性)是确保数据规范录入的工具。当你需要为某个单元格设置一个固定的下拉选项列表时,这个列表的来源就需要被“固定”。通常的做法是,在一个单独的、不影响主表的位置(比如一个隐藏的工作表)建立一个列表,然后在数据验证的“来源”框中,通过绝对引用(如“=$Z$1:$Z$10”)来指向这个列表区域。这样,无论你在哪个单元格设置验证,下拉菜单的内容都来自这个固定的、统一的源。 图表数据系列的固定引用 创建图表时,如果数据源使用的是相对引用,那么当你在表格中插入或删除行/列后,图表的数据范围可能会错乱,导致图表显示异常。一个良好的习惯是,在最初选择图表数据源时,就使用绝对引用地址。或者,更推荐的方法是使用“表格”(Table)功能来组织你的数据源。当你将数据区域转换为表格后,再以此创建图表,图表的数据系列引用会自动变为结构化引用,这种引用方式对数据范围的增减有更好的适应性,本质上也是一种更稳固的“固定”。 固定值在条件格式规则中的重要性 使用条件格式时,规则中的公式引用也至关重要。例如,你想高亮显示整个A列中数值大于B1单元格(一个作为阈值的固定单元格)的单元格。如果你为A2单元格设置规则公式为“=A2>$B$1”,那么由于B1被绝对引用,这个规则应用到A列其他单元格(如A3、A4)时,比较的对象始终是B1。如果错误地写成“=A2>B1”(相对引用),那么应用到A3时规则会变成“=A3>B2”,这就完全偏离了你的本意。 跨工作表和工作簿的固定引用 当公式需要引用其他工作表甚至其他工作簿中的固定值时,绝对引用的概念依然适用,只是写法上更复杂一些。跨工作表引用格式为“工作表名!单元格地址”,例如“=Sheet2!$A$1”。跨工作簿引用则包含工作簿名、工作表名和单元格地址。在这种复杂引用中,固定单元格地址(使用$符号)同样能防止引用错位。尤其需要注意的是,如果被引用的外部工作簿关闭,引用路径会包含完整路径,此时更需确保地址的绝对性,以免链接混乱。 常见错误排查:为什么“固定”的值还是变了 即使你使用了美元符号,有时还是会发现预期固定的值在复制公式后发生了变化。这通常有几个原因:一是可能只锁定了行或列,而另一个方向没锁,需要检查美元符号的位置。二是公式中可能通过其他函数间接引用了可变区域。三是如果你使用了“剪切”和“粘贴”操作,而非“复制”和“粘贴”,那么即使是被绝对引用的单元格,其地址也可能根据粘贴位置发生调整,这是Excel的一个特殊逻辑。 从理念上超越“固定”:使用表格与结构化引用 对于追求高效和规范的数据处理者,我强烈建议使用Excel的“表格”功能(快捷键Ctrl+T)。将你的数据区域转换为表格后,列标题会变成字段名,在公式中引用时,会使用像“表1[单价]”这样的结构化引用。这种引用方式是基于列名的,不依赖于具体的单元格位置。当表格扩展或你在中间插入列时,公式会自动适应,这比单纯地“固定”某个单元格区域更加智能和稳健,代表了更先进的表格构建理念。 总结与最佳实践建议 回到最初的问题“excel公式里固定一个值的函数是什么”,现在我们知道了,它不是一个函数,而是一种通过美元符号($)控制单元格引用行为的技术。掌握它,是成为Excel熟练用户的必经之路。在实际操作中,我的建议是:首先,明确你要固定的对象是一个点(单个单元格)、一条线(一行或一列)还是一个面(一个区域)。其次,善用F4快捷键提高效率。最后,对于重要的、作为参数使用的固定值,考虑使用“名称”来管理,这将使你的表格更清晰、更专业,也更容易维护。理解了这些,你就能从容应对各种复杂的计算场景,让数据真正为你所用。
推荐文章
对于用户提出的“excel公式填充整列快捷键是哪个选项”这一问题,最直接快捷的答案是使用快捷键“Ctrl+D”(向下填充)或“Ctrl+R”(向右填充),但更高效且适用于整列填充的场景是双击填充柄或使用“Ctrl+Enter”组合键配合选区。本文将深入解析这些快捷键的适用情境、操作细节以及相关的进阶技巧,帮助您彻底掌握在Excel中快速将公式应用到整列的高效方法。
2026-03-16 20:50:23
253人看过
针对“excel公式填充整列快捷键是什么键”这一问题,核心方法是使用键盘上的“Ctrl键”加“D键”组合,可以快速将上方单元格的公式或内容向下填充至选定区域,若需向右填充则可使用“Ctrl键”加“R键”。
2026-03-16 20:48:38
373人看过
在Excel中,若希望公式填充时指定内容保持不变,关键在于使用绝对引用,即通过美元符号($)锁定行号或列标,例如将A1改为$A$1,即可在拖动填充时固定该单元格引用。掌握此技巧能有效避免数据错位,提升表格处理的准确性与效率。
2026-03-16 20:47:07
160人看过
在Excel中,快速向下填充公式的快捷键是Ctrl加D,而向右填充公式的快捷键是Ctrl加R;若需一次性将公式填充至连续区域的底部,可双击填充柄或使用Ctrl加Shift加向下箭头组合键选中区域后按Ctrl加D。掌握这些核心快捷键能极大提升数据处理的效率与流畅度。
2026-03-16 20:46:03
217人看过
.webp)

.webp)
.webp)